2016-02-05 70 views
1

我正在嘗試開發Excel加載項(n00b)。Excel對象未定義

當使用Office.context時,我設法做了一些事情(創建表格和輸入等等)。

但現在我想進入不同的單元格,並且所有示例似乎都運行稱爲Excel的對象運行方法。 (https://github.com/OfficeDev/office-js-docs/blob/master/excel/excel-add-ins-programming-overview.md

但是,當試圖使用Excel時,它是未定義的。我正在運行Excel 2013.是否需要使用2016?

回答

1

如果您需要可在Excel 2013中使用的JavaScript API,請參閱原始JavaScript API Reference頁面。

APIs you're asking about僅在Office 2016及更高版本中可用。

-Michael(PM for Office加載項)

+1

這是無稽之談,API沒有反向移植到Office 2013。 –

2

正如文章所述,「適用於:Excel 2016,Office 2016」。

他們在最近添加了一些新的API,目前只適用於Excel & Word 2016,用於Windows桌面。即使在Office.context中的更通用的東西中,也有很多東西只適用於某些特定的平臺(例如,僅限於在線或僅在桌面上,或不在2013年...)。 2016年桌面產品具有最多的功能。